Scenario

A partner asks for an additional workflow before tomorrow's demo. Adding it improves narrative completeness but reduces rehearsal time for the current flow. Holding scope protects execution reliability but risks partner trust in responsiveness.

OPTION A

Push for narrower demo scope

Scoring effects: assertiveness -4.0, candor -2.0

OPTION B

Absorb request and rework plan

Scoring effects: assertiveness +4.0, candor +2.0
